tests: Add ability to test uPy cmdline executable.

This allows to test options passed to cmdline executable, as well as the
behaviour of the REPL.

@ -28,10 +28,46 @@ def rm_f(fname):
def run_micropython(pyb, args, test_file):
if pyb is None:
# run on PC
try:
output_mupy = subprocess.check_output([MICROPYTHON, '-X', 'emit=' + args.emit, test_file])
except subprocess.CalledProcessError:
output_mupy = b'CRASH'
if test_file.startswith('cmdline/'):
# special handling for tests of the unix cmdline program
# check for any cmdline options needed for this test
args = [MICROPYTHON]
with open(test_file, 'rb') as f:
line = f.readline()
if line.startswith(b'# cmdline:'):
args += line[10:].strip().split()
# run the test, possibly with redirected input
try:
if test_file.startswith('cmdline/repl_'):
f = open(test_file, 'rb')
output_mupy = subprocess.check_output(args, stdin=f)
f.close()
else:
output_mupy = subprocess.check_output(args + [test_file])
except subprocess.CalledProcessError:
output_mupy = b'CRASH'
# erase parts of the output that are not stable across runs
with open(test_file + '.exp', 'rb') as f:
lines_exp = f.readlines()
lines_mupy = [line + b'\n' for line in output_mupy.split(b'\n')]
if output_mupy.endswith(b'\n'):
lines_mupy = lines_mupy[:-1] # remove erroneous last empty line
if len(lines_mupy) == len(lines_exp):
for i in range(len(lines_mupy)):
pos = lines_exp[i].find(b'######')
if pos != -1 and len(lines_mupy[i]) >= pos:
lines_mupy[i] = lines_mupy[i][:pos] + b'######\n'
output_mupy = b''.join(lines_mupy)
else:
# a standard test
try:
output_mupy = subprocess.check_output([MICROPYTHON, '-X', 'emit=' + args.emit, test_file])
except subprocess.CalledProcessError:
output_mupy = b'CRASH'
